Currently, allow's enter into the leading sorts of metal roof covering to consider as 2025 strategies. Standing joint steel roof is composed of panels that are up and down seamed with each other. The joints are increased, developing a streamlined and contemporary look. This style conceals the fasteners under the panels, stopping leaks and providing a clean, sleek appearance.
This kind of metal roofing is optimal for contemporary and minimal home layouts. The standing seams permit the material to expand and contract with temperature changes, decreasing the risk of warping. With less revealed elements, standing seam steel roof coverings require little maintenance - https://giphy.com/channel/ro0fnutsga. This roof design is best for homes in areas with extreme weather.

Metal roof shingles resemble the look of conventional roofing products like slate, timber drinks, or tiles while supplying the sturdiness of steel. They are smaller panels, usually interlocking for added strength and defense. Metal shingles been available in many styles and colors, imitating high-end materials like cedar trembles or clay ceramic tiles without the high maintenance.
With appropriate installation and treatment, steel shingles can last upwards of 50 years. Metal roof shingles are ideal for property owners who want the look of a typical roof however with boosted resilience and climate resistance. They fit well in neighborhoods where maintaining a traditional appearance is crucial while still supplying modern-day benefits.

Corrugated panels are commonly among one of the most budget-friendly kinds of steel roof. Lots of corrugated metal roofings include finishings like galvanized zinc or aluminum to improve toughness and withstand rust.
